The appeal used in this statement, "People who eat chocolate are 72% happier than those who don't, so that means we should eat chocolate every single day," is an emotional appeal, also known as pathos.

By stating this, the speaker tries to evoke a positive emotion in the audience. This statement also uses a logical fallacy known as "post hoc ergo propter hoc," which means that because two things are correlated, it doesn't necessarily mean that one causes the other. In this case, eating chocolate may not necessarily be the sole reason for a person's happiness.

Furthermore, the evidence does not necessarily support the conclusion that we should eat chocolate daily. Moderation is key when consuming sweets, and excessive chocolate consumption can have negative health consequences.

In conclusion, while there may be some correlation between eating chocolate and happiness, evaluating the evidence critically is important as not jumping to conclusions based on emotional appeals or logical fallacies.

"The Boy in the Striped Pyjamas" is a novel and later a movie that tells the story of two young boys living in Nazi Germany during the Holocaust. The novel is written from the perspective of a young boy named Bruno and is a powerful commentary on the horrors of the Holocaust.

The main message of "The Boy in the Striped Pyjamas" is about the innocence and naivety of childhood, and the dangers of prejudice and hate. Through the relationship between Bruno and Shmuel, the boy in the striped pyjamas who he meets at the concentration camp, the novel illustrates the senseless and cruel nature of the Holocaust.

The novel shows how easily people can become involved in acts of evil and cruelty, simply because they are following orders or going along with what everyone else is doing. It highlights the importance of standing up for what is right, even when it is difficult, and the dangers of blindly accepting hateful ideologies.

The pyjamas worn by the Jewish prisoners in the concentration camp symbolize their dehumanization and the loss of their individuality. The fact that they are all dressed the same, despite their different backgrounds and personalities, serves to emphasize the inhumanity of the Holocaust.

The Evolving Human Skeleton
Our early ancestors were hunter-gatherers who obtained food by hunting and by searching for edible wild plants. They needed strong bones, including large, strong jaws that enabled them to eat tough, uncooked foods. When our ancestors developed agriculture, however, their diet changed. They began growing plants, such as grains and beans, and raising animals for food; they also started cooking their foods, making them softer and easier to chew. Consequently, the human skeleton underwent radical changes. Over time, the human jaw became smaller and changed shape. Other bones also evolved, becoming lighter, especially in the joints, as a result of both dietary changes and a less active lifestyle.

Hinduism and Western religions share several similarities, including the belief in one supreme being, the importance of prayer and worship, and the concept of an afterlife or reincarnation.

Both Hinduism and Western religions also have scriptures that guide their followers, such as the Bhagavad Gita in Hinduism and the Bible in Christianity. Additionally, they both emphasize ethical behavior and the pursuit of spiritual enlightenment. However, it is important to note that there are also significant differences between Hinduism and Western religions, such as the absence of a formal religious hierarchy in Hinduism and the focus on karma and dharma in Hinduism rather than sin and salvation in Western religions.

What is concentration gradient?

A substance's concentration gradient is the difference between its concentrations at two places. In biology, chemicals are often transported between regions of high and low concentration in order to balance the concentration and preserve homeostasis. Passive transport is the term for this process, which takes place without the requirement for external energy.

However, there are times when a drug has to be transferred against the gradient of its concentration, that is, from a region of low concentration to one of high concentration. Active transport uses the input of energy, often in the form of ATP (adenosine triphosphate), to move the material despite the gradient that exists naturally.

In the novel Roll of Thunder, Hear My Cry, Cassie Logan sees a reason for Stacy's feelings of responsibility for TJ because their father, David Logan, has taught his children to take care of one another and to be responsible for their actions as well as their family members' actions.

He has also trained them to have a strong sense of their own worth and to be self-respecting. Therefore, Stacy feels responsible for TJ because he believes that TJ's poor choices may reflect poorly on their family and community. Additionally, Stacy sees TJ as a friend, and he cares for him. So, he takes TJ's care and safety upon himself because he believes that it is his responsibility as a friend to protect him.

Cassie also recognizes this because she too shares the same sense of responsibility as Stacy. This is seen when they accompany TJ to the Wallace store and wait for him outside to ensure his safety because they know that there are people who would like to hurt him because of his bad reputation.
